About Botanic Cottages
Right then, Botanic Cottages. If you're coming to Southport and want something a bit more personal than your standard hotel chain, this could be a shout. It's smack bang in the town centre, so dead easy for getting about. Good if you don't want to be stuck out in the sticks.
I've had a nosey at the reviews β seems like most people rate it around 4.5 stars, and they've got a good few reviews clocked up. Looks like people rate the cleanliness and the friendly staff, which is always a bonus. From what I can see, it looks more suited to couples or maybe smaller families, rather than big groups.
Now, if you're thinking of coming up for The Open at Birkdale in 2026 (12-19 July), this could be a decent option as itβs not far. Just be aware that everything in Southport gets booked up solid that week, so get your skates on. You can give them a bell on the number on this page to check for availability and prices.
One thing to remember is parking in the town centre can be a pain, so factor that in. You might want to look into parking options nearby before you arrive to save yourself a headache.
